Transaction 2666d10383b9ff2e273f7a65051c24ff77f8119ba925f8bfb34331f801c90614
2 Input
2 Outputs
- 2666d10383b9ff2e273f7a65051c24ff77f8119ba925f8bfb34331f801c90614:0
- 2666d10383b9ff2e273f7a65051c24ff77f8119ba925f8bfb34331f801c90614:1
value 18000000
address 3LpRGgPjgXR5FXsi1AuWJBomSnuv1stjgK
value 7926260
address 1HcsHeUCSeDuzJgsR4pA4GrmrEoEYFi9L7